Kolhapur is on the brink of a significant transformation as plans for the establishment of an IT Park gain momentum. This initiative marks a crucial step toward strengthening the district’s industrial and technological landscape, with a strong focus on time-bound execution and long-term economic impact.
The proposal, emphasized by Prakash Abitkar, highlights the importance of structured planning to accelerate development and position Kolhapur as an emerging technology hub.
Background and Key Developments
A felicitation ceremony organized by the IT Association of Kolhapur at Shenda Park marked a milestone following government approval for the IT Park project.
The event brought together key leaders and stakeholders, including:
- Prakash Abitkar (Guardian Minister)
- Rajesh Kshirsagar (MLA)
- Ruparani Nikam (Mayor)
Their collective vision reflects a shared commitment to placing Kolhapur firmly on the map of modern technological advancement.
Strategic Vision for Kolhapur’s Growth
The IT Park is part of a broader development agenda aimed at enhancing Kolhapur’s infrastructure and economic potential. Key complementary developments include:
- Establishment of a circuit bench of the High Court
- Development initiatives linked to Mahalaxmi Temple Kolhapur
- Allocation of funds for Jyotiba Temple development
- Efforts to include Panhala Fort in the UNESCO World Heritage list
Together, these initiatives signal a comprehensive approach to regional growth that blends cultural heritage with modern infrastructure.
